The Last Holocaust Train
The last holocaust train of infamous history
With the box cars of rusted steel
Seemed coated with patina of dry innocent blood
Turned the wheels to roll to Auschwitz
Take destiny to the door of death.
The cramped squalid space suffocating
The helpless doomed in deadly darkness
Thin streaks of sunbeam stifled
Like the rays of hope throttled
Never to breathe in the free air.
When the journey between life and death would end
No one knew until the train doors opened
Those who rose from the debris of the dead
Saw the last sunshine of the departing day
Extinguish in the gas chamber.
